What Goes Into Architecture Plans?
Architecture plans are official documents that communicate the full design of a structure before work gets underway. They typically cover floor plans, elevation drawings, structural layouts, plumbing diagrams, and finish schedules. These documents function as the primary working blueprint between the owner, the architect, the builder, and the municipal office.
Mechanically, the creation of architecture plans involves multiple areas of expertise working in coordination. A licensed architect converts your requirements into scaled documents that incorporate structural engineering, zoning laws, setback requirements, and material capabilities. The result is a package of drawings that tells every trade exactly what to install and how.

The Architecture Plans Journey Step by Step
- Defining the Vision — Our professionals begin by meeting with you to gather your requirements. We review the function of the space, your investment ceiling, your schedule, and any specific design preferences you have in mind. This discovery session guides the entire direction of your architecture plans.
- Assessing the Build Site — Before any drawing begins, our experts perform a thorough on-site evaluation. We assess topography, access points, boundary restrictions, and sun orientation that will influence the architecture plans.
- Creating the Initial Design Concept — With site data in hand, our architects develop schematic drawings that show the overall layout. These early documents allow you to review the overall look of your project and offer input before we advance further into detailed documentation.
- Refining the Architecture Plans — After your approval, our architects move into full detailed drawing. This step is where architecture plans gain their full depth. We add electrical pathways, system notes, and dimension-accurate floor plans and elevations.
- Permit Submission Preparation — Our team organize the finished set of architecture plans into a filing document that satisfies every local permit office requirements. We handle the zoning compliance documents and communicate with your contractor to confirm everything is aligned.
- Addressing Reviewer Comments — Most projects go through at least one correction phase. Our team respond to plan check items efficiently and thoroughly, revising your architecture plans to meet all flagged items.
- Ongoing Field Coordination — Once permits are granted, our experts stay accessible throughout project execution. We answer questions as field conditions require them, and we prepare as-built drawings at project completion.

Architecture Plans FAQ
How long does it usually to develop a full set of architecture plans?
Duration depends based on scope and size. Straightforward residential projects like garage conversions often take between four to eight weeks from first meeting to filing. More complex projects such as commercial buildings often take three to six months to bring to permit-ready status. Our professionals will give you a clear completion window at your first consultation.
What is the price range for architecture plans in Walnut Creek?
Fees are shaped by project size. Straightforward additions may cost approximately a few thousand dollars, while complex multi-unit buildings can involve significantly higher professional costs. Golden State Builders Group offers transparent pricing so you have no surprises before work begins.
What materials do I need to provide to start the architecture plans process?
To kick off your architecture plans, it helps to have a copy of your property survey, any as-built records on the building, a clear description of the intended work, and your target start date. Our team can manage whatever documentation you have available and obtain what may be missing.
Will the architecture plans need to get signed by a licensed architect?
In most cases, yes. California permit offices demand that plans for new construction bear the official credentials of a California-licensed architect or structural engineer. At Golden State Builders Group, all architecture plans are prepared and stamped by our credentialed team, ensuring full compliance with state and local requirements.
Can architecture plans be changed after submission?
Yes, but modifications once filed trigger a plan change application with the city, which adds time and cost. That is why our professionals spend significant effort in producing accurate documents before the first submission is made. Investing in detail early saves significant time and money later in the project.
